Long-term blocking of malware based on port number is futile. What will you do when the next malware that uses dynamic ports 1025-65535 hits the 'net? Block 1025-65535? It’s hard to read with your rules so randomly organized. I’m guessing you’re probably already adversely affecting some small number of sessions due to them attempting to start on ports you’ve blocked. Sure, you can compensate with related/established rules perhaps, but it’s not worth the effort. If you aren’t forwarding the ports to inside hosts, there’s nothing to protect from ancient malware anyway.

Short-term, I can see reacting to certain outbreak by blocking a specific port, but not for very long.
